What is a Modular BOT Chain Algorithmic Network?

At its core, the Modular BOT Chain Algorithmic Network is an advanced form of interconnected automation that leverages modular design principles to create a flexible, scalable, and highly efficient network. Think of it as the backbone of a highly sophisticated, intelligent system that connects various automated entities, known as BOTs (Business Operational Tools), into a cohesive and responsive whole.

Modularity: The modularity of the BOT Chain is akin to the way biological systems operate; it allows for individual components to be independently designed, upgraded, and replaced without disrupting the entire system. This characteristic ensures that the network remains robust and adaptable to changing requirements.

Algorithmic Design: The network is powered by sophisticated algorithms that facilitate seamless communication and coordination among the BOTs. These algorithms are designed to optimize performance, enhance decision-making, and ensure that the network operates at peak efficiency.

One of the most accessible and popular entry points into the crypto income play is staking. Staking is the process of actively participating in the operation of a proof-of-stake (PoS) blockchain. In this consensus mechanism, validators are chosen to create new blocks based on the amount of cryptocurrency they hold and are willing to "stake" as collateral. By staking your coins, you're essentially lending them to the network, contributing to its security and decentralization, and in return, you receive rewards, typically in the form of more of the same cryptocurrency. The annual percentage yield (APY) for staking can vary significantly depending on the specific cryptocurrency and the network's activity, but it often ranges from a few percent to well over 10%, sometimes even higher for newer or less established PoS coins.

Choosing which coins to stake requires careful research. Look for projects with robust security, a strong development team, and a clear use case. Understanding the lock-up periods (how long your staked assets are inaccessible) and the potential for slashing (penalties for validator misbehavior) is also crucial. Platforms like Binance, Coinbase, and Kraken offer user-friendly interfaces for staking, abstracting away much of the technical complexity. For the more technically inclined, running your own validator node offers higher potential rewards but also comes with greater responsibility and technical expertise. The passive nature of staking is a significant draw; once set up, your crypto is working for you, earning rewards without requiring constant attention.

Beyond staking, lending your crypto assets offers another compelling income stream. In DeFi, lending platforms allow you to lend your digital assets to borrowers who need them for various purposes, such as margin trading or taking out collateralized loans. In exchange for lending your crypto, you earn interest. These platforms operate on smart contracts, which automate the lending and borrowing process, ensuring transparency and efficiency. Popular lending protocols include Aave, Compound, and MakerDAO.

The interest rates on crypto lending can fluctuate based on supply and demand, but they often present attractive yields compared to traditional savings accounts. You can typically deposit your crypto into a lending pool, and the platform automatically distributes the earned interest. The risk associated with lending primarily stems from the smart contract risk (the possibility of vulnerabilities in the code) and the potential for impermanent loss if you're also providing liquidity to decentralized exchanges (which we'll touch on later). However, many platforms offer collateralized loans, reducing the risk of default. Diversifying your lending across multiple reputable platforms can further mitigate risk.

Perhaps one of the most innovative and potentially lucrative aspects of the crypto income play is yield farming. This strategy involves providing liquidity to decentralized exchanges (DEXs) and earning rewards in the form of trading fees and often additional governance tokens. When you provide liquidity to a DEX like Uniswap or SushiSwap, you deposit a pair of cryptocurrencies (e.g., ETH and DAI) into a liquidity pool. Traders then use this pool to swap one token for another, and a small fee is charged on each transaction. These fees are then distributed proportionally to the liquidity providers.

Yield farming goes a step further by often incentivizing liquidity provision with native tokens. Many DeFi protocols issue their own governance tokens, and to bootstrap their ecosystem, they distribute these tokens to users who actively participate, such as by providing liquidity. This can lead to exceptionally high APYs, especially in the early stages of a new project. However, yield farming is also considered one of the higher-risk strategies within the crypto income play due to several factors.

The primary risk is impermanent loss. This occurs when the price ratio of the two assets you've deposited into a liquidity pool changes significantly. If one asset skyrockets in value relative to the other, you'll have fewer of the appreciating asset and more of the depreciating one when you withdraw your liquidity. While the trading fees and token rewards can often offset impermanent loss, it's a concept that requires careful understanding. Additionally, smart contract risk is a significant concern, as hacks and exploits can lead to the loss of deposited funds. Furthermore, the complexity of yield farming, with its intricate strategies and ever-changing landscape of pools and incentives, demands continuous learning and active management.

The rise of Non-Fungible Tokens (NFTs) has also opened up new avenues for generating income, moving beyond just speculative art sales. NFT rentals are emerging as a fascinating income play. In games like Axie Infinity or virtual worlds such as Decentraland, owning powerful NFTs or valuable virtual land can be a significant investment. However, not everyone has the capital to acquire these assets. This is where NFT rentals come in. Owners can rent out their NFTs to other players who want to utilize them for in-game advantages or virtual land functionalities without the upfront cost. This creates a recurring revenue stream for the NFT owner.

Similarly, NFT staking is gaining traction. Some NFT projects are starting to integrate staking mechanisms, allowing holders to lock up their NFTs to earn rewards, often in the form of the project's native token or other benefits. This incentivizes long-term holding and adds utility to digital collectibles. The NFT rental and staking space is still relatively nascent, but its growth potential is substantial as the NFT ecosystem matures and finds more real-world applications. The key here is to identify NFTs with genuine utility and demand within their respective ecosystems, whether it's for gaming, virtual real estate, or other decentralized applications.

Constructing a diversified crypto income portfolio is akin to building a traditional investment portfolio, but with a unique set of digital assets and mechanisms. Diversification is key to mitigating risk. Instead of putting all your eggs into one basket, spread your investments across different types of income-generating strategies and cryptocurrencies. This could involve allocating a portion of your portfolio to stable, lower-yield staking of well-established cryptocurrencies like Ethereum (post-merge) or Cardano, which offer relative stability and proven network security. Another portion could be allocated to lending platforms, diversifying across different protocols and asset types.

For those with a higher risk tolerance and a deeper understanding of DeFi, allocating a portion to yield farming can offer significantly higher returns, but this should be done with extreme caution and thorough research. Consider strategies that involve stablecoin farming, which generally carries less risk of impermanent loss compared to volatile asset pairs. Furthermore, explore opportunities in different blockchain ecosystems. While Ethereum remains a dominant force in DeFi, other networks like Solana, Polygon, and Binance Smart Chain offer their own unique income-generating opportunities and often lower transaction fees, making them more accessible for smaller investments.

When selecting cryptocurrencies for your income play, prioritize projects with strong fundamentals: a clear use case, active development, a committed community, and a sustainable tokenomics model. Avoid chasing hype or investing in projects solely based on their current high APY, as these yields are often unsustainable and can be a sign of Ponzi-like schemes or inflationary token distribution that will eventually devalue your holdings. Research the underlying technology, the team behind the project, and their long-term vision. A well-researched and diversified portfolio will be more resilient to market fluctuations and protocol-specific risks.

Risk management is not an option in the crypto income play; it is a necessity. The inherent volatility of the crypto market, coupled with the complexities of smart contracts and the nascent nature of many DeFi protocols, means that risks are ever-present. One of the most fundamental risk management techniques is position sizing. Never invest more than you can afford to lose. This golden rule applies to all forms of investing, but it's especially critical in the crypto space. Start with smaller amounts and gradually increase your allocation as you gain experience and confidence.

Due diligence is your best friend. Before committing any capital to a staking pool, lending protocol, or yield farming opportunity, conduct thorough research. Read the project's whitepaper, understand its mechanics, audit reports of smart contracts (if available), and research the team's reputation. Look for established protocols with a track record of security and transparency. Be wary of projects that are too new, lack clear documentation, or promise impossibly high returns with little explanation.

Diversifying your wallets and platforms is another crucial risk management strategy. Don't store all your crypto assets on a single exchange or in a single DeFi protocol. Utilize a combination of hardware wallets for long-term storage, reputable exchanges for trading and staking, and multiple DeFi platforms for lending and yield farming. This reduces the impact of a single point of failure, whether it's an exchange hack, a smart contract exploit, or a platform going offline.

Understanding impermanent loss is critical for anyone engaging in yield farming. While the potential rewards can be enticing, the risk of impermanent loss can erode your principal if the price divergence between the two assets in a liquidity pool becomes significant. Some strategies, like farming stablecoin pairs or using platforms that offer impermanent loss mitigation tools, can help, but it’s a risk that must be continually monitored.

Staying informed is a continuous process. The crypto landscape evolves at an astonishing pace. New protocols emerge daily, existing ones are updated, and market conditions can shift dramatically. Subscribe to reputable crypto news outlets, follow respected analysts and developers on social media (with a critical eye), and actively participate in community forums. Understanding regulatory changes and their potential impact on your crypto income strategies is also vital.
